On november 29, 1975, president gerald ford signed into law the education for all handicapped children act (public law 94-142), now known as the individuals with disabilities education act (idea). In adopting this landmark civil rights measure, congress opened public school doors for millions of children with disabilities and laid the foundation of the country’s commitment to ensuring that children with disabilities have opportunities to develop their talents, share their gifts, and contribute to their communities.

Group 1 attorneys (birth month january through june) are due to report compliance with the continuing legal education (cle) requirement during the 2020 attorney registration process. Pursuant to bcle reg. 402:1, attorneys who report that they have not completed the cle requirement by 12/31/2019 will be assessed a $50 noncompliance fee and given a grace period until 06/26/2020 to complete their cle requirement. Upon completion of the cle credits, they must return to the on-line registration system to report final compliance on or before 06/26/2020. After the expiration of the grace period, attorneys can no longer report cle compliance through the on-line registration system.
The district of columbia bar has no mandatory continuing legal education requirements at this time, which also means that we have no cle accreditation body and do not accredit courses. We do not certify cle providers or keep records of our members’ attendance at other providers’ cle courses for the same reason. While the d. C. Bar requires members to maintain their legal competence, we do not specify the means and do not require that attorneys submit attendance documentation from any courses they attend.

Next » 1. A. In each school district of the state, each minor from six to sixteen years of age shall attend upon full time instruction. B. Each minor from six to sixteen years of age on an indian reservation shall attend upon full time day instruction. C. For purposes of this article, a minor who becomes six years of age on or before the first of december in any school year shall be required to attend upon full time instruction from the first day that the appropriate public schools are in session in september of such school year, and a minor who becomes six years of age after the first of december in any school year shall be required to attend upon full time instruction from the first day of session in the following september;  and, except as otherwise provided in subdivision three of this section, shall be required to remain in attendance until the last day of session in the school year in which the minor becomes sixteen years of age.

The right to education has been recognized as a human right in a number of international conventions, including the international covenant on economic, social and cultural rights which recognizes a right to free, compulsory primary education for all, an obligation to develop secondary education accessible to all, on particular by the progressive introduction of free secondary education, as well as an obligation to develop equitable access to higher education , ideally by the progressive introduction of free higher education. Today, almost 75 million children across the world are prevented from going to school each day. As of 2015, 164 states were parties to the covenant.
Champa v. Weston public schools , 473 mass. 86 (2015). A "settlement agreement, regarding a public school's placement of a student who required special education services in an out-of-district private educational institution, between the public school and the parents of the student was exempt from the definition of “public records†and therefore not subject to disclosure without a redaction of personally identifiable information".

Students enrolled in law clinics develop important professional skills as members of professional legal teams. Under the direction of clinical program faculty, clinic students provide legal advice and litigation or transactional assistance to clients on a wide range of legal matters from individual disputes or transactions, to complex litigation and policy advocacy, to creating property rights in intellectual property, to advising the development of new legal entities and organizational policies. Washington university students from disciplines such as social work, engineering, environmental studies, and medicine also enroll in some of the clinics.
